White Lies is an English post-punk band formed in Ealing, West London in 2007. The band consists of Harry McVeigh (lead vocals, guitar), Charles Cave (bass, backing vocals), and Jack Lawrence-Brown (drums). The band's music is characterized by its dark and atmospheric sound, drawing influences from 80s post-punk and new wave bands such as Joy Division and Depeche Mode. White Lies gained popularity with their debut album, "To Lose My Life..." in 2009, which reached number one on the UK Albums Chart. The album spawned hit singles such as "Death" and "Farewell to the Fairground." White Lies continued to achieve success with their subsequent albums, including "Ritual" (2011) and "Big TV" (2013).
